11 Jul, 2024

11 Reasons Why Companies Outsource

Amidst fast-paced and competitive markets, companies seek ways to streamline operations, reduce costs, and stay ahead of the competition. One compelling strategy is outsourcing, particularly in software development. According to a recent study by Deloitte, over 70% of companies who outsourced their work did so to cut costs and improve efficiency. This trend is not just a fleeting phenomenon but a strategic move many businesses adopt to remain agile and innovative.

As renowned management consultant Peter Drucker  famously said, “Do what you do best and outsource the rest.” This quote encapsulates the essence of why companies outsource. By focusing on their core competencies and entrusting other tasks to external experts, businesses can boost their overall performance and drive growth.

Why Companies Outsource

But what drives this shift towards outsourcing? Why do companies (both large and small) opt to delegate their software development needs to external partners? In this article, we will delve into the top 11 reasons why companies choose to outsource

Getting to Know Companies That Outsource

Outsourcing software development is a strategy used by many top companies to save costs, access global talent, and speed up innovation. There is a constant fight between nearshore vs. offshore outsourcing, but the truth is that they both bring successful outcomes if they suit your business. Now, let’s explore some of the foremost examples of companies that have succeeded by outsourcing.

Apple: The Use of Global Expertise

Apple outsources parts of its software development to enhance its products efficiently. For example, Siri voice recognition was developed by external experts. This allows Apple to integrate advanced features quickly and maintain its innovative edge.

Slack: Early Success

Slack’s Early Success is a testament to the significant growth potential that outsourcing can bring. By outsourcing the development of its mobile apps to MetaLab, Slack was able to rapidly create a user-friendly mobile experience. This move significantly contributed to its growth, as evidenced by its current 38.8 million active users.

Skype: Global Reach

Skype outsourced much of its early software development to a team in Estonia. This decision was crucial for Skype as it allowed it to offer a high-quality communication tool that quickly gained worldwide popularity. Skype now has over 2.27 billion active users.

Alibaba: Initial Growth

Alibaba outsourced its website development to U.S. developers in its early years. This helped Alibaba overcome technical challenges and build a robust platform, which consequently led to its massive success. Alibaba now has over 163 million monthly active users across its platforms.

GitHub: Expanding Features

GitHub outsourced the development of its Atom text editor. This way,  GitHub enhanced its offerings without pulling resources from its core platform. The company continues to be the leading platform for developers, with over 30 million users.

Why Do Companies Outsource?: 11 Reasons

From cost savings to gaining a competitive edge, we will explore the benefits that outsourcing brings to the table. You may be a startup looking to scale quickly or an established enterprise aiming to focus on core activities. Knowing these reasons can help you decide whether to integrate outsourcing into your business strategy.

Here are the top 11 reasons why companies choose to outsource.

Reason 1. Cost Efficiency

Outsourcing can lead to significant reductions in operational costs. By hiring external teams, companies can save on salaries, benefits, and overhead expenses. For instance, businesses often save up from 40% to 60% on labor costs by outsourcing. LITSLINK offers competitive pricing models, which help companies achieve substantial cost savings without compromising on quality.Why Companies Outsource

Reason 2. Access to Global Talent

By outsourcing, companies gain access to a vast pool of global talent. They can tap into specialized skills and expertise that might not be available locally. The diversity in talent leads to innovative solutions and top-notch work. LITSLINK boasts a team of over 300 highly skilled tech professionals from around the world, each bringing unique expertise to every project.

Reason 3. Focus on Core Business Activities

Outsourcing non-core functions lets companies concentrate on their primary business goals. The improved focus, therefore, boosts efficiency and drives growth. By outsourcing IT support, a company can dedicate more resources to product development and marketing. 

Reason 4. Scalability and Flexibility

One of the biggest advantages of outsourcing is the ability to scale operations based on demand. Companies looking to outsource can quickly adapt to market changes without the burden of hiring and training new employees. This flexibility is especially crucial for businesses experiencing rapid growth or seasonal demand. As a software development outsourcing company, LITSLINK has a proven track record of providing scalable solutions tailored to your business needs. With years of experience and multiple success cases, we ensure you can adjust resources as required.Why Companies Outsource

Reason 5. Access to Advanced Technologies

Business outsourcing companies often have access to the latest technologies and tools. By leveraging these advanced resources, companies can stay competitive and innovative without significant investments in new technology. LITSLINK’s team is constantly learning and exploring cutting-edge technologies to deliver state-of-the-art software solutions. Besides, we have tech specialists who are experts in different technologies. For instance, if you need a software developer who knows a specific programming language like Python, we’ll provide one. 

Reason 6. Risk Management

By sharing responsibilities with outsourcing partners, companies can reduce the impact of market fluctuations, regulatory changes, and other uncertainties. This risk distribution helps stabilize operations and ensures continuity. LITSLINK has a proven track record of managing complex projects, which reduces risks for our clients through reliable and consistent delivery.

Reason 7. Faster Time to Market

External teams often have the expertise and resources to speed up development timelines, which is crucial for staying ahead of the competition. LITSLINK’s efficient development processes and experienced team ensure your projects are completed on time, which helps you reach the market faster. In fact, due to our agile approach and expertise, we complete projects 30-50% faster than our competitors. 

Reason 8. Enhanced Service Quality

Specialized business outsourcing companies often have higher standards and more experience in their fields. This results in better outcomes. The improved quality leads to enhanced customer satisfaction and loyalty. LITSLINK prides itself on delivering high-quality software solutions that exceed client expectations and foster long-term partnerships.

Reason 9. Competitive Advantage

Outsourcing allows companies to focus on strategic initiatives and innovation, which provides a competitive edge. By delegating routine tasks, businesses can allocate more resources to areas that differentiate them from competitors. Outsourcing teams help companies maintain a competitive advantage by delivering innovative solutions and freeing up internal resources for core activities.

Reason 10. Focus on Innovation

When non-essential tasks are outsourced, internal teams can concentrate on innovation. This focus on creativity and new ideas helps companies stay relevant and competitive in a rapidly changing market. LITSLINK’s dedicated R&D team stays ahead of technology trends and ensures your projects incorporate the latest innovations.

Reason 11. Better Resource Management

By outsourcing time-consuming or specialized skills-intensive tasks, companies can use their resources more effectively, leading to increased productivity and efficiency. At LITSLINK, we understand the importance of resource management. We ensure efficient resource management and provide the right talent for your project needs, optimizing workflows for maximum productivity and giving you the reassurance of a well-managed company.

Wrapping Up

Outsourcing is not just a trend; it’s a strategic decision that can significantly enhance your business operations. From cost savings and access to global talent to better focus on core activities and faster time to market, the benefits of outsourcing are clear and compelling. Companies like Apple, Slack, and Skype have successfully leveraged outsourcing to achieve remarkable growth and innovation. By considering outsourcing, you can also tap into these benefits and take your business to the next level.

At LITSLINK, we understand the unique challenges and opportunities that outsourcing presents. With our team of 300+ skilled professionals, cutting-edge technologies, and a proven track record of delivering high-quality software solutions, we are well-equipped to help you achieve your business goals. Whether you need to scale your operations, access specialized skills, or accelerate your project timelines, LITSLINK is here to support you every step of the way.

